Schwarz Group’s expanding e-vehicle charger network
Germany’s Schwarz Group is expanding its network of e-charging stations in Europe. With this step the company will have approximately 6,200 e-charging points by the end of its 2022 financial year. This will result in a total of around 13,000 e-charging points across the group’s retail network.
